The famous Italian football coach Oronzo Canà has retired to a villa in Apulia. Now, old and tired, he is enjoying a quiet life there, cultivating his vineyard, when suddenly he is summoned to Milan, in northern Italy. There the elderly chairman of a great Lombard ("Longobarda") club is suffering from dementia and has lost his powers of judgement, and the club's manager has been fired. He has decided to bring back Oronzo Canà as trainer, remembering him from his great football team of thirty years before, tasking him with bringing the club back to its old winning ways. Oronzo puts his trust in the intervention of a Russian billionaire who has bought the club for promotion. But it is a deception.

Critical Reception

L'allenatore nel pallone 2 was met with a generally lukewarm reception from critics, primarily seen as a nostalgic sequel for fans of the original film. While Lino Banfi's performance was appreciated for its comedic timing, the plot was often criticized for being predictable and relying heavily on the established formula of the first movie. Audience reception was more favorable among those who enjoyed the original, appreciating the return of a beloved character.

Fun Fact

The film serves as a sequel to the 1984 cult classic 'L'allenatore nel pallone,' bringing back Lino Banfi as the beloved football coach Oronzo Canà after a 24-year gap.
